**Seat map fails to render balcony tiers (Orpheum Vale layout)**

If the StageGrid renderer shows blank balcony sections, first confirm the venue layout version matches the booking snapshot. Mismatched versions cause silent polygon drops. Clear the layout cache, then re-fetch the manifest from the Curtainline API. The re-fetch endpoint requires authentication, so use the token below.

session JWT of yawep-yawep = eyJhbGciOiJIUzI1NiIsInR5cCI6IkpXVCJ9.eyJzdWIiOiI3pWF3_In0.aXYsHiog

# Build Provenance: Scanbright Barcode Integration

The Scanbright scanner module ships as a signed artifact built in an isolated runner. No third-party binaries; all deps pinned by digest. Provenance attestation covers source revision, builder image, and test results. Security review should confirm the attestation chain before approving deployment to kiosk fleets. The attested build is identified by the token below.

pipeline stamp: htk31_f769b577b3028a4e9958e5bb8d1259a

## Tuning

Date localization in Calendrix is driven entirely by runtime constants rather than compile-time flags, so reviewers should verify that any change here is reflected in both the formatter cache and the locale fallback chain. Pay particular attention to cache eviction: an oversized locale cache bloats memory on multi-tenant hosts, while an undersized one causes repeated pattern recompilation for long-tail locales. The constants below were benchmarked against the Ostrava fixture set. Current values follow.

tuning constants:
QUOTAS = {
    "druwyn": 5,
    "holix": 5,
    "zorath": 5,
    "holwyn": 10,
}

Runbook: Fixturesmith test-data factory. Fixturesmith seeds deterministic fixtures for integration runs. If CI flakes with duplicate-key errors, the seed pool is exhausted — bump the pool size or reset the sequence table. Do not run the reset job against shared staging during business hours; it truncates tenant fixtures. Restart the factory daemon after any change. Active daemon configuration follows.

service settings:
[casax]
port = 6379
team = rusir
host = casax.zemvarhq.corp
region = outer-4
access_code = ac_9808ce
timeout_ms = 1500